Top 5 Consumer Finance Apps in the US for Q4 2022
In Q4 2022, the top consumer finance apps in the US showcased varied performance trends in weekly downloads, revenue, and active users. Data from Sensor Tower highlights these trends.
In the last quarter of 2022, the top consumer finance applications in the United States demonstrated significant trends in weekly downloads, revenue, and active users. This analysis, based on data from Sensor Tower, covers the performance of Rocket Money - Bills & Budgets, YNAB, EveryDollar: Personal Budget, SimplyWise: Receipt Scanner, and Quicken Simplifi: Budget Smart.
Rocket Money - Bills & Budgets saw a dynamic quarter, with weekly revenue peaking at around $189K in mid-October and fluctuating throughout the period, ending the year at approximately $126K. Weekly downloads spiked dramatically to 366K in the last week of December, and active users followed a similar upward trend, reaching nearly 1.7M by the end of the quarter.
YNAB experienced relatively stable weekly revenue, with a notable peak of $139K at the end of October. Downloads remained consistent, with a significant increase to 26.5K in the final week of December. Active users fluctuated slightly but ended the quarter at around 93.5K.
EveryDollar: Personal Budget showed varied performance in weekly revenue, peaking at $115K in mid-October and ending December with figures around $65K. Downloads saw a notable rise to 22K in the final week of December. Active users also increased, reaching approximately 309K by the end of the year.
SimplyWise: Receipt Scanner maintained steady weekly revenue, consistently around the $15K mark, with a slight peak at $19K in mid-November. Downloads saw a gradual increase, peaking at 5.7K in the last week of December. Active users steadily grew, ending the quarter at around 54K.
Quicken Simplifi: Budget Smart had a consistent performance in weekly revenue, hovering around the $15K mark, with minor fluctuations. Downloads saw a significant peak at 9.7K in the last week of December. Active users increased steadily, reaching nearly 30K by the end of the quarter.
